LATE SPORTING

TROTTER 'AND OWNER DISQUALIFIED*. IS IT A NEW ZEALAND HORSE? ■y Telegraph.— Preis Auociatloo.— Cogrrigfct. (Received July 10, 11.20 ajn.) SYDNEY, This Day. The New South Wales Trotting Club disqualified the trotter ■ Ring Off, late Bilfy, and his present ownei* fed' life, considering that the horse was identical with Coral Hue, a well-known performer in New Zealand. The man who brought the horse from Brisbane and ' sold' it to the present owner was also disqualified for life.
